Does anybody know what the video footage of the spoken lines that appears in the WAY Live DVD is about? I can tell that Al is the man, but is this from a possible video for the song or something?

Posted: Fri Dec 15, 2006 11:37 pm
by Kevbo1987
I think it was just something that Al put together for the tour. I know Al wanted to do a video for JS, and Jerry Springer himself even agreed to appear in it, but when he heard the song, he felt it was too mean-spirited. I don't think he ever started filming the video though.
